Strategic Architectural Evolution: Zulfiqar Paracha’s Enduring Legacy
For over four decades, Zulfiqar Paracha has precisely calibrated the standard for opulent living in Pakistan. His extensive experience encompasses landmark public works, including the Pakistan Monument and the State Bank of Pakistan, alongside bespoke luxury private residences. Consequently, Paracha has emerged as a seasoned professional, driving innovation within the construction industry with both professional rigor and profound passion.
Significantly, Paracha’s global architectural insights, cultivated through extensive travel, propelled him to focus on designer residences in Pakistan from 1999 onwards. These homes transcend mere physical structures; instead, they are conceived as meaningful spaces prioritizing family, comfort, and artisanal craftsmanship. His design philosophy, influenced by Mediterranean and Spanish styles, systematically prioritizes openness, natural light, and optimal ventilation, thereby creating inherently warm and welcoming environments. Grounded in ethical planning and inspired creation, Paracha’s methodology has precisely positioned him as a leading figure within Karachi’s premium residential sector.

The Heritage: A Blueprint for Elevated Living in Luxury Property Pakistan
This disciplined philosophy culminates in his latest residential offering, The Heritage—a home that embodies cultural inspiration, modern luxury, and family-centered living. The nomenclature itself precisely reflects Paracha’s belief in drawing from diverse global influences while structurally adhering to local identity. Architecturally inspired by Moroccan design, this residence strategically showcases rich textures, artisanal craftsmanship, and timeless elegance, all woven within a contemporary framework.
Sustainability and community are intrinsically integrated into the project’s core vision. Through a dedicated Plantation Drive, trees are methodically planted along every street developed by Paracha, thereby creating shaded avenues and fostering a greener, more liveable urban environment. This vital connection to nature extends into the home’s interior; landscaping by Durya Kazi introduces significant greenery and even trees indoors, seamlessly blending interior and exterior spaces for optimized natural integration.
At its operational core, The Heritage is structurally designed to foster family connection while meticulously preserving individual privacy. The expansive layout encourages togetherness without compromise, offering spaces that feel both open and intimate. Specifically, the residence comprises six bedrooms, with two situated on the ground floor and four on the first floor, purposefully supporting multigenerational living with systematic ease and comfort.
Precision Engineering in Residential Design: Inside The Heritage
The master suite functions as a serene sanctuary, strategically overlooking a tranquil pool and featuring a generously proportioned walk-in closet. Refined materials precisely elevate the space; these include hand-spun silk wallpaper within the master bedroom and hand-cut Murano glass mosaic detailing in the powder bathroom. Consequently, artisanal craftsmanship is highlighted at every turn, demonstrating a calibrated approach to interior design.

Entertainment and wellness are seamlessly integrated within the home’s structural design. The basement, for instance, operates as a self-contained unit, equipped with a private gym, a versatile multi-purpose hall, and a dedicated family lounge. This strategic allocation allows for leisure and recreation without disrupting the main living areas. Furthermore, a fully equipped Italian kitchen anchors the home’s social and culinary spaces, while the installation of a smart home system provides effortless, centralized control over lighting and other key operational functions.
